Transaction 37c64b85da88d18410fd09aeddfa04f08c932aafb2ee22f840703d1f7c17a798

block
2526bb1be76dd29d9b1d551df12833fb53132938eb1c740b3d34a15d2cafa39e

1 Input

9 Outputs